Create Movie Using AVFoundation

Steps to Create Movie Using AVFoundation:-
1. Create a AVMutableComposition
CFAbsoluteTime currentTime = CFAbsoluteTimeGetCurrent(); //Debug purpose - used to calculate the total time taken
NSError *error = nil;
AVMutableComposition *saveComposition = [AVMutableComposition composition];
2. Get the video and audio file path
NSString *tempPath = NSTemporaryDirectory();
NSString *videoPath = nil ;//<Video file path>;
NSString *audioPath = nil ;//<Audio file path>;;
3. Create the video asset 
NSURL * url1 = [[NSURL alloc] initFileURLWithPath:videoPath];
AVURLAsset *video = [AVURLAsset URLAssetWithURL:url1 options:nil];
[url1 release];
4. Get the AVMutableCompositionTrack for video and add the video track to it.
The method insertTimeRange: ofTrack: atTime: decides the what portion of the video to be added and also where the video track should appear in the final video created.
AVMutableCompositionTrack *compositionVideoTrack = [ addMutableTrackWithMediaType:AVMediaTypeVideo preferredTrackID:kCMPersistentTrackID_Invalid];
AVAssetTrack *clipVideoTrack = [[video tracksWithMediaType:AVMediaTypeVideo] objectAtIndex:0];
[compositionVideoTrack insertTimeRange:CMTimeRangeMake(kCMTimeZero, [video duration])  ofTrack:clipVideoTrack atTime:kCMTimeZero error:nil];
NSLog(@"%f %@",CMTimeGetSeconds([video duration]),error);

5. Create the Audio asset 
NSURL * url2 = [[NSURL alloc] initFileURLWithPath:audioPath];
AVURLAsset *audio = [AVURLAsset URLAssetWithURL:url2 options:nil];
[url2 release];

6. Get the AVMutableCompositionTrack for audio and add the audio track to it.
AVMutableCompositionTrack *compositionAudioTrack = [saveComposition addMutableTrackWithMediaType:AVMediaTypeAudio preferredTrackID:kCMPersistentTrackID_Invalid];
AVAssetTrack *clipAudioTrack = [[audio tracksWithMediaType:AVMediaTypeAudio] objectAtIndex:0];
[compositionAudioTrack insertTimeRange:CMTimeRangeMake(kCMTimeZero, [audio duration])  ofTrack:clipAudioTrack atTime:kCMTimeZero error:nil];
NSLog(@"%f %@",CMTimeGetSeconds([audio duration]),error);
7. Get file path for of the final video.
NSString *path = [tempPath stringByAppendingPathComponent:@"mergedvideo.mov"];
if([[NSFileManager defaultManager] fileExistsAtPath:path])
{
[[NSFileManager defaultManager] removeItemAtPath:path error:nil];
}
NSURL *url = [[NSURL alloc] initFileURLWithPath: path];

8. Create the AVAssetExportSession and set the preset to it.
The completion handler will be called upon the completion of the export.
AVAssetExportSession *exporter = [[[AVAssetExportSession alloc] initWithAsset:saveComposition presetName:AVAssetExportPresetHighestQuality] autorelease];
exporter.outputURL=url;
exporter.outputFileType=[[exporter supportedFileTypes] objectAtIndex:0];
[exporter exportAsynchronouslyWithCompletionHandler:^{
NSLog(@"export completed : %lf",CFAbsoluteTimeGetCurrent()-currentTime);
}];

The above technique can be used to merge N number of video and audio tracks and create a movie. I hope this tutorial helps to create movie using AVFoundation.

Integrating google analytics into Blogger

It's very important to keep track of the traffic that your site receives. So, Google Analytics the way to go.It's very simple to integrate Google analytics into Blogger.Follow these steps
  1. Sign into Google Analytics
  2. create your profile.
  3. fill the details like your blogger URL, time zone etc
  4. hit continue and Copy the code
  5. Sign into blogger
  6. Click on the 'Layout' Tab, then click on 'Edit HTML'
  7. Paste the code between the header tag as shown . <head>........ paste your code here </head>
  8. Press 'Save Template' to save the changes.
  9. Back in Google Analytics, click on 'Check Status' or 'Verify Tracking Code' under the Status column. Once your tracking code has been verified, the status will change to: 'Receiving Data.'
